Requirements
-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field (or equivalent work experience).
- 3-5 years of experience as a Salesforce Developer, working with Salesforce CRM platforms.
- Strong proficiency in Apex, Lightning Web Components (LWC), Visualforce, and Salesforce APIs.
- Experience with Salesforce integrations (REST/SOAP), middleware tools and third-party APIs.
- Salesforce Platform Developer I certification is required; Platform Developer II or additional certifications are a plus.
- Familiarity with development tools like Git, VS Code, Ant Migration Tool, and CI/CD processes.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ills, with attention to detail.
-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
- Excellent communication skills to effectively interact with technical and non-technical stakeholders.

Northmarq was voted by Real Estate Forum as one of The Best Places to Work in Commercial Real Estate! We are looking for an experienced Salesforce Developer to join our team. The ideal candidate will design, develop, and implement customized solutions within the Salesforce platform to meet evolving business needs. This role will involve collaborating with other developers, administrators, and stakeholders to create scalable solutions and deliver quality work. *This role supports a flexible schedule that prioritizes in ‑ office teamwork, with flexibility for remote work when appropriate. Position Responsibilities: Custom Development: Develop custom Salesforce solutions using Apex, Lightning Components (Aura & LWC), Visualforce, and Salesforce APIs. Integrations: Design and build integrations with external applications using REST/SOAP APIs, or other middleware tools. Configuration & Customization: Work closely with the Salesforce Admin team to configure standard functionalities, develop custom triggers, classes, and batch processes, and implement workflows, process builders, and flows. Technical Architecture: Collaborate with stakeholders to translate business requirements into scalable, high-performing technical solutions and recommend architecture best practices. Testing & Quality Assurance: Develop and execute unit tests, perform code reviews, and ensure the quality and security of the codebase. Data Management: Handle data migration, mapping, and transformation processes using data management tools like Data Loader, Workbench, and ETL tools. Documentation: Create and maintain technical documentation, including coding standards, release notes, and best practices. Salesforce Releases: Stay updated with Salesforce releases, new features, and best practices, and recommend and implement upgrades as needed.
